New Delhi: Sunil Gavaskar's batting brilliance is second to none. Memories of him saving Test matches for India continue to inspire generations after generations. And his exploits have already become stuff legends are made of.

In a previously unheard of stories, former Mumbai batsman Shishir Hattangadi shared that legendary Don Bradman once hailed Gavaskar as an opener, "who can save you Test matches".

Speaking at the 67th birthday of the legendary opener at the Cricket Club of India on Sunday night, Hattangadi remebered Bradman saying, "I like to see him play. I haven't seen an opening batsman over the years, who can save you Test matches, because it takes one decision or an indecision to get out. And he's being able to do it with a great amount of success."

Hattangadi, who opened with Gavaskar for MCI, had a chance meeting with the Australian legend during a tour Down Under with the CCI team in 1985.

"Obviously we came back feeling proud as Indians, that the great Bradman was so complimentary about 'our' Gavaskar. And people who know Bradman, know that he wasn't liberal with his praises. He was a hard man to please," Hattangadi added.
